The traditional tattoo approach of lining, shading and coloring (in that order) never appealed much to James Hall (or Jake for that matter). James has spent the majority of his tattoo career moonlighting as an oil painter and it definitely comes across in his tattoo work. In today’s episode we talk about the value of working in other mediums, James’ annual art show focused on encouraging tattoo artists to pick up a paint brush and how to create a studio environment that attracts the clientele you are looking for.
